IF people don’t go for your single at $200 a pop, why not just charge them – oh – $2 million for the whole album?
That’s the cunning marketing plan being employed by former KISS guitarist Vinnie Vincent with his long-promised Guitarmageddon album, which has been the subject of all kinds of bonkers plans from the former Ankh Warrior.
“It’s been a long time in the making,” Vincent, 73, wrote on Facebook. “I am very proud of this very special album.
“The entire album will be offered in master format only for $2,000,000. This includes 10 songs mixed in master, final product format, all the master files of the artwork, related posters, and 10 separate vinyl and CD packaging art for each individual song, should the buyer choose to release the album on a per-song basis.
“The buyer can choose to release the entire album in any format they desire … vinyl, CD, or any other configuration, in whole or in part, at their discretion. All marketing plans and ideas require approval by Vinnie Vincent. The price does not include any right, title, or interest in the copyrights and/or trademarks related to Vinnie Vincent or the product itself.
“If the buyer wishes to purchase any associated rights in the compositions, a separate agreement can be arranged and negotiated. The price will also include a perpetual license to use the brand name ‘Vinnie Vincent Invasion’ and ‘Vinnie Vincent’ for the life of the album.”
Alternatively the buyer – presumably someone with record industry aspirations, deep pockets and poor judgement – can buy songs for $200,000 each, subject to the same conditions as above.
Two million US dollars is A$2,862,400.
